当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

迷你sql,迷你SQL数据库与ASP服务器集成指南

迷你sql,迷你SQL数据库与ASP服务器集成指南

本指南将详细介绍如何将迷你SQL数据库与ASP服务器进行集成,你需要安装并配置迷你SQL数据库,然后创建一个ASP页面来连接到该数据库,使用ADO.NET或OleDb等...

本指南将详细介绍如何将迷你SQL数据库与ASP服务器进行集成,你需要安装并配置迷你SQL数据库,然后创建一个ASP页面来连接到该数据库,使用ADO.NET或OleDb等数据访问技术编写代码以执行查询和更新操作,确保安全性和性能优化措施到位,如加密敏感信息和使用索引以提高查询效率,通过遵循这些步骤,你可以轻松地将迷你SQL数据库集成到你的ASP应用程序中。

迷你SQL(MiniSQL)是一款轻量级、高性能的关系型数据库管理系统,特别适合小型应用程序和开发环境使用,而迷你ASP服务器(SWS ASP Web Server),则是一个开源的小型Web服务器,支持ASP脚本执行,本文将详细介绍如何将迷你SQL数据库与迷你ASP服务器进行集成,实现数据存储和管理功能。

准备工作

安装迷你SQL数据库

首先需要下载并安装迷你SQL数据库,可以从官方网站这里下载最新版本,并根据操作系统选择相应的安装包进行安装。

安装完成后,启动迷你SQL服务,确保数据库正常运行。

安装迷你ASP服务器

同样地,从官方网站这里下载迷你ASP服务器最新版本,并进行安装,在安装过程中,请确保配置好所需的网络端口和服务路径

迷你sql,迷你SQL数据库与ASP服务器集成指南

图片来源于网络,如有侵权联系删除

安装完毕后,启动迷你ASP服务器,确认其正常工作状态。

创建数据库和数据表

在迷你SQL中创建一个新的数据库和数据表,以便后续操作,以下是一个简单的示例:

CREATE DATABASE myapp;
USE myapp;
CREATE TABLE users (
    id INT AUTO_INCREMENT PRIMARY KEY,
    username VARCHAR(50),
    password VARCHAR(100)
);

这个例子创建了一个名为myapp的数据库和一个包含用户信息的users表。

编写ASP脚本连接数据库

为了使ASP页面能够访问迷你SQL数据库,我们需要编写相应的ASP脚本来处理数据库连接和查询操作,以下是连接数据库的基本代码示例:

<%
Dim conn, connStr
connStr = "DRIVER={MiniSQL};SERVER=localhost;DATABASE=myapp;"
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open connStr
%>
<!-- 在此处添加您的数据库查询和其他逻辑 -->

这段代码通过ADO对象创建了一个数据库连接,并将其打开,您可以在ASP页面上使用该连接对象执行各种数据库操作。

执行数据库操作

在ASP脚本中,我们可以利用ADO对象来执行插入、更新、删除等数据库操作,以下是如何向users表中插入一条记录的代码:

迷你sql,迷你SQL数据库与ASP服务器集成指南

图片来源于网络,如有侵权联系删除

<%
Dim cmd, sql
sql = "INSERT INTO users (username, password) VALUES ('testuser', 'password123')"
Set cmd = Server.CreateObject("ADODB.Command")
cmd.ActiveConnection = conn
cmd.CommandText = sql
cmd.Execute()
%>

这段代码创建了一个命令对象,设置了命令文本为插入语句,然后调用Execute()方法执行这条语句。

安全考虑

在使用迷你SQL数据库时,请注意以下几点以确保安全性:

  • 加密密码:不要直接存储明文的用户密码,而是应该使用哈希函数对密码进行加密后再存储到数据库中。
  • 输入验证:对所有来自客户端的数据进行严格的验证和清洗,以防止注入攻击和其他安全问题。
  • 权限控制:合理分配数据库用户的权限,避免不必要的风险。

测试与应用

完成上述步骤后,您可以编写一些测试用例来验证数据库操作的准确性,可以通过编写多个ASP页面来实现不同的业务需求,如注册、登录、信息管理等。

通过以上步骤,我们已经成功地将迷你SQL数据库与迷你ASP服务器进行了集成,这种组合方式非常适合快速开发和部署小型Web应用,同时也提供了良好的可扩展性和性能表现,希望这篇文章能帮助到正在寻找解决方案的开发者们,让他们的项目更加高效和安全!

黑狐家游戏

发表评论

最新文章